Meet Wombat! She is the sweetest girl ever once you get to know her! She will lay on the couch all day, run errands with you, and loves her walks. She is great during car rides. She`s such a smart girl-- she know sit, shake, and spin! She has never needed a crate and is potty trained. she has done well with respectful small children in her foster home. In doggy playgroups at the shelter, she was social and sweet. Wombat is the best dog and would love to be your companion!

Young-Williams Animal Center is the municipal animal shelter for Knox County and the City of Knoxville and is a 501(c)(3) not-for-profit organization serving . We are dedicated to the sheltering and placement of animals and general animal welfare. We are an open-intake facility and care for more than 11,000 annually. Our goal at Young-Williams Animal Center is to find “forever” homes for all our adoptable animals!
